Wonderful Wet Meadows

Ruddy Darter dragonfly on reed

Distance: 1.5 miles

Terrain: grass pathways throughout the route with several bridges

Starting point: Waltham Abbey Gardens car park, Abbey View, Waltham Abbey, Essex EN9 2ES

At at glance information for this route

A circular river route around Cornmill Meadows. Experience and discover the wealth of wildlife that feed on the wetland meadows.



Directions

  • From Waltham Abbey Gardens car park follow the pathway into the gardens towards the building

  • At the pavement sign at the end of the railings of the Parish Office, turn right and head north crossing the wooden bridge over Cornmill Stream

  • Follow the path through the underpass and into Cornmill Meadows

  • Bear to the right along the fence line until you reach the kissing gate

  • Proceed through the gate, passing an information panel and Abbey Fish Ponds

  • Continue on the grass path alongside the river heading north, passing the inlet sluice

  • Proceed through the kissing gate and continue on the pathway past an information panel

  • From the weir, continue along the pathway, following the Old River Lee in a westerly direction, bearing to the left to head south

  • At the third information panel, proceed through the kissing gate and over a wooden bridge

  • Continue on the pathway passing a path on the left

  • Proceed south alongside the river and the Royal Gunpowder Mills site on the right, crossing over the large bridge and onto a footbridge over the outlet sluice

  • Turn left before the kissing gate and follow the pathway east, keeping the road on the right

  • Continue through a kissing gate and turn right, retracing the route through the underpass returning into Waltham Abbey Gardens and car park
